How much do tech chat support jobs pay per year?

As of Aug 21, 2026, the average yearly pay for tech chat support in Atlanta, GA is $41,813.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$36,100.00 and $45,200.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is a Tech Chat Support?

A Tech Chat Support job involves assisting customers with technical issues through online chat. Support agents help troubleshoot problems, provide guidance on product usage, and resolve technical concerns efficiently. They typically work with predefined scripts, troubleshooting steps, and knowledge bases to offer accurate solutions. Strong communication skills, technical knowledge, and patience are crucial for success in this role.

What are the typical daily responsibilities of a Tech Chat Support?

As a Tech Chat Support professional, your day usually involves responding to customer inquiries and troubleshooting technical issues via live chat platforms. You'll document each interaction, follow established procedures to resolve problems, and escalate more complex issues to higher-level support when needed. The role often requires multitasking across several chats at once and collaborating with other support team members to share information or updates. This fast-paced, customer-focused environment helps build strong communication and problem-solving skills while providing valuable technical support experience.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Tech Chat Support,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Tech Chat Support, you need strong troubleshooting abilities, a good understanding of computer systems and applications, and typically a high school diploma or relevant technical certification. Familiarity with help desk ticketing systems, live chat platforms, and knowledge bases is often required. Excellent written communication, patience, and a customer-focused attitude are standout soft skills in this role. These skills and qualities help ensure that customer issues are resolved efficiently and with a positive experience, directly impacting customer satisfaction and company reputation.

Job description

The Service Desk Agent is the first point of contact for the users who call our IT Service Desk. While providing the highest level of customer service, the Service Desk Agent answers incoming calls, tracks all information in a call tracking system, uses a knowledge base tool along with their expertise to resolve issues in a timely fashion. The Service Desk Agent is focused on providing best in class customer service, achieving high levels of first call resolution, and identifying opportunities to streamline/automate agent process.
Responsibilities include:
Demonstrate strong customer service skills to provide phone support including:
o Listening to the customer to gain an accurate understanding of the situation
o Being empathetic to the customer's situation and having a sense of urgency to resolve the issue
o Producing accurate, detailed documentation at the client, problem and incident level
o Resolving conflict
Responsible for high quality end-user technical support, related to enterprise software and hardware
Responsibilities include assessment, triage, research, training/education and resolution of incidents and requests regarding the use of application software products and/or infrastructure components in a fast paced 7x24x365 environment.
Under general oversight, provides after hours and weekend support as needed.
The position requires attention to detail, follow through, teamwork focus and positive attitude.
An understanding of technology and the ability to apply that knowledge to support all existing systems
Supports all aspects of client support and immediate computing needs while demonstrating professionalism and composure on the phone, via an online chat and/or in person
Create a positive customer support experience, build rapport and trust with end users through professional attitude and approach to problem understanding, ensuring timely resolution or escalation by providing urgency, business impact evaluation and communicating the status to the end user promptly
Identifies and works with internal end users to provide guidance and support, sound communications and customer service principles without becoming unprofessional in difficult situations
Provides investigation, diagnosis, resolution and recovery for hardware/software problems #DICE
Installs, modifies, cleans up, run diagnostic programs and repairs computer hardware/ peripherals and software
Qualifications:
Excellent customer service skills required
Excellent communication skills required
Two to five years of proven, qualified related work experience in a comparable complex, high tech and fast paced work environment
Preferred work experience in technical support role but not required
Required Education: High school diploma or GED with relevant work experience
Ability to diagnose the cause of problems in a complex environment and to provide effective solutions quickly
Self motivated and ability to work on own initiative in a high pressure environment
Willing to work variable shifts including evenings, weekends and public holidays
